Present your bodies as a living sacrifice, holy and pleasing to God. —Romans 12:1
God’s call to lay down our lives on the altar of sacrifice means that we give Him all that we are—first for a lifetime and then day by day, moment by moment.
Does that seem too much to ask? Truthfully, there are moments when I feel as if something God is asking of me is unreasonable. It may be to provide a listening ear for one more woman when I’m spent at the end of a long day. It may be to stay engaged in a relationship with a difficult person.
In those moments, my emotions sometimes cry out, “I just can’t give any more.” But that’s when I need to take a trip to Calvary and look into the eyes of a bleeding Christ who gave everything to reconcile me to Himself.
God asks us to offer up our lives and daily circumstances as a living sacrifice, signifying our wholehearted surrender to the One who gave His life for us. Shall we offer Him only our affordable gifts or all that we are and have?
